Boston: Atlantic Monthly Press. Very Good in Good dust jacket; Jacket lightly worn.. 1986. First Edition. Hardcover. 0871130637 . Index, notes. Analyzes Viet Nam War as a military campaign that was conducted as a corporate production, where officers were managers, enlisted soldiers were workers, and the product was an enemy death tally. ; 8vo 8" - 9" tall; 523 pages .

About Old Saratoga Books

Old Saratoga Books owners Dan and Rachel Jagareski have been selling books since 1996. After running an open shop for twenty years in the historic village of Schuylerville we now sell books online and at book fairs. We are members of the Independent Online Booksellers Association (IOBA). Our specialties include books about history, science, cooking, children's books, and the arts. Rachel is a graduate of the Colorado Antiquarian Book Seminar and has attended Rare Book School in Charlottesville, Virginia.
